ATV Access on Local Roads

ATV Access

on Local Roads

Many local roads in Campbell County and LaFollette are accessible by ATV. You must comply with all local and state laws. Riding on state and local roads is permitted from 30 minutes before dawn until 30 minutes after dusk.  If operating an ATV on a public roadway, the driver must be at least 16 years old and be able to provide proof of liability insurance upon request. All riders must wear helmets.

Hwy 25W in front of Walden Woods is an ATV-approved road from the property stretching towards LaFollette at the intersection of McCloud Trail.
